Abstract: A gateway device including an access interface to an external network, a trunked interface, and translation logic. The access interface is associated with multiple external source addresses. The trunked interface is interfaced with multiple different virtual local area networks (VLANs), where each VLAN is associated with a corresponding VLAN tag and at least one of potentially overlapping internal source addresses. The translation logic translates between each external source address and each unique combination of internal source address and VLAN tag. A method of network address translation including assigning one of first network addresses to each first device of a first network, dividing the first network into a plurality of VLANs, separating the first devices with the same first network address into different VLANs, and assigning first devices with the same first address to different second network addresses.

Abstract: An application reservation and delivery system with capacity pooling including a logical resource pool, an application library, a resource manager, and a deployment manager. The logical resource pool includes computer resource assets which includes asset type, amount, and asset source in which each computer resource asset is decomposed to a specified level of granularity. The application library includes application configurations, each including at least one server configuration and computer resource asset requirements. The resource manager tracks availability of the computer resource assets, receives requests for specific application configurations for specified time periods, compares each requested application configuration with available computer resource assets at the specified time periods, and reserves resources for each requested application configuration during the specified time periods. The deployment manager deploys each requested application configuration using the reserved resources.

Abstract: A system, apparatus, method, and computer program product that automate the deployment of reference implementation architectures for pre-integrated multi-product or sub-product capability cloud IT service delivery solutions. The apparatus comprises a sizing tool and a deployment automation tool. The sizing tool determines the attributes of the resources that are required to provide the service delivery solution, and determines the quantity those resources that are required to provide a particular service level based on those attributes. And the deployment automation tool generates software bundles or virtual appliances that operate together to provide the service delivery solution when they are installed on the resources. The service delivery solution comprises a base console that is configured to invoke processes on a plurality of interchangeable containers, wherein each of the plurality containers provides different functionality for delivering different services or service offerings.
